I'm from the UK and we dont really have 'yard sales' as such very often. However in the last decade or so 'car boot sales' have become really popular. I was up really late last night sorting, pricing and loading the car with our accumulated clutter. I was at the boot sale area at 7.30 am this morning and still had to wait while the organisers checked to see if there was room. It was packed! The sun shone all morning ,which is pretty unusual for the UK
Loads of people turned up to buy and by 1 pm I was £80 richer! Well £70 if you allow for the rent, £4 on some used clothing for DD, then £2 on juice and doughnuts. I know if I was a real budget board expert I would have pre-packed a snack but I'm only a newbie I am going to change this tomorrow into dollars for our disney trip in October and that way I know I won't fritter it beforehand.
